DHT reduces thymus cellularity independently of estrogen receptors. 9-month-old male WT and DERKO mice were orchidectomized and treated for 4 weeks with E2 (0.05 μg/day) or DHT (45 μg/day), administered by s.c. silastic implants. Vehicle animals received empty implants. The E2-mediated reduction of thymus cellularity seen in WT mice, could not be detected in DERKO mice. Treatment with DHT resulted in a dramatic reduction of thymus cellularity independently of ER genotype. One-way ANOVA followed by Fisher's test was used to compare data from mice in different treatment groups. Results are presented as mean ± standard deviation. ***P < 0.001
